Gorgeous custom 1977 Pontiac Trans Am Super Street category car (street legal). This automobile only has 2000 km (1,242 miles) on it and has not been raced since completion in 2008 and receiving it’s spectacular paint job that cost $40,000. The car went on to win 1st place at the 56th annual Autorama in 2008. The engine is a 572 cubic inch Merlin motor that ran 810 hp on a dyno and at 5000 rpm produced 750 foot pounds of torque. The transmission is a Turbo 400 with 4500 stall converter. The car has a 10 point cage and chassis with four link suspension and tubular upper and lower control arms. Brakes are Strange Engineering ventilated four puck caliper disc brakes. A handmade sheet metal housing contains 35 spline Strange Engineering axles. There is stainless steel sheet metal interior from front dash to rear dash. Included are detachable wheelie bars.
